Our Values
Our values guide how we live and learn together. Each month we focus on one value – such as kindness, respect, trust and friendship – exploring it in assemblies, lessons and daily school life. Pupils are encouraged to reflect on how these values link to life in modern Britain and are celebrated when they model them in action.
Learning Behaviours
We believe good learning grows from positive behaviours. Our approach helps children to be:
• Resilient – ready to keep going even when learning is hard
• Collaborative – working well with others
• Creative – curious thinkers who follow their ideas
• Responsible – making thoughtful choices about their learning and, about how they treat others
Together, our vision, values and learning behaviours help every child thrive academically, socially and emotionally. This strong ethos enriches school life and supports children to become thoughtful, confident citizens.
